Mazal Tov: Astrology and the KabbalahEvery Other Monday until January 23Next Session: Monday, Jan. 2 at 7:00 p.mCo-led by Alina Bloomgarden & Rina Lankry. This course will explore astrology as a language and tool for self-knowledge.! Together, western astrology and Kabbalistic Astrology will be introduced.! Students will be invited to have their charts calculated and then used as a learning tool as well as an element of analytic methodology.

Living Deeply with a Sacred Text First Sunday of Every Month Next Session: Sunday, Jan. 1 at 6:30 p.m 131 Riverside Drive, Apt 10DLed by Nili Weissman. This popular course is back for another round of Torah cycle. This course will help you develop skills to live deeply with your pasuk, verse of Torah, that you chose on Simchat Torah. We meet once a month to witness, support and listen to stories of the verse's unfolding in our lives. This year-long journey o"ers a unique experience of learning Torah from each other as we learn how to listen deeply to a sacred text in our lives.

OmekBeginning Thursday, January 12Thursdays, 8:00PM-10:00 p.m. 260 Riverside Drive, 7BThis class, taught by Rabbi Ingber, will follow one thinker/one book through the cycle of the yearly Torah Reading. Week by week, we will explore a teaching from this particular Master’s approach to the Parsha (weekly portion). This year we will be learning “Me’or Eynayim," a Chassidic classic written by Rabbi Nachum of Chernobyl. !

My ReincarnationFilm ScreeningThursday, Dec. 15, 5:30PMCinema Village22E 12th StreetJoin acclaimed documentarian Jennifer Fox and Rabbi David Inbger for a discussion after the film. MY REINCARNATION chronicles the epic story of the high Tibetan Buddhist Master, Chögyal Namkhai Norbu, and his western-born son, Yeshi. The film follows the Master to greatness as a Buddhist teacher in the West, while his son, Yeshi, recognized at birth as the reincarnation of a famous spiritual master, breaks away from his father’s tradition to embrace the modern world. Can the father convince his son to keep the family’s spiritual legacy alive? Fox expertly distills a decades-long drama into a universal story about love, transformation, and destiny.

The Zohar: The Book of Light...and Darkness Every Sunday until January 23 at 8:00 p.mThis course is o"ered by member Nathaniel Berman, who has been studying the Zohar for many years. This course will be an intensive intellectual and experiential introduction to the Zohar, the central text of Kabbalah, also called the "poetry of Kabbalah." No prior background, except spiritual questing, is required for this course.
